Banur -Tepla road on the way to become economic power house of punjab, giving a boost to the regional economy

Posted on January 19, 2022 By

Chandigarh (Punjab) [India], January 19: Only 8 minutes drive from Aerocity and strategically located on NH 205A, the Banur – Tepla road is all set to give a fillip to business growth & the economy with leading real estate groups of the region planning to set up Industrial Parks on the stretch.

A not very known industrial stretch a few years back, the Banur-Tepla road is now a hub of warehousing facilities with over 40 warehousing and logistics entities based here and over a dozen under construction. Not only warehousing, the ‘Industrial spot’ located on the Banur-Tepla road has become a hot economic hub.

The region has a  strategic location from the supply chain and logistics perspective with prominent catchment areas in and around Punjab, which has the Baddi- Barotiwala- Nalagarh industrial belt and Ludhiana which is a key industrial hub. In addition to proximity to the dry port at Shambhu bordering Punjab and Haryana, connectivity to Amritsar-Kolkata Industrial Corridor (AKIC) with the Airport cargo road from Mohali International Airport to be contacted here in future, the area is all set to give a major boost to industrial development, investment ecosystem and economy of the region.

Ashish Mittal Director Royale Estate group adds that all these key features make the Banur – Tepla stretch a preferred choice for many industry verticals and all kinds of industries – Red Zone, white, orange, green, ranging from textiles, chemicals, pharmaceuticals, tools and precision, assembling units, printing press, building material, warehousing solutions, cold storages, engineering and fabrication units, electrical and electronic items, food and food processing, ceramics and refractories, distillery, pesticides and many more.

The state government, too, has designed a policy around eight core strategic pillars for the sustainable industrial growth of Punjab. These are infrastructure, power, MSMEs, ease of doing business, start-up and entrepreneurship, skills, fiscal and non-fiscal incentives and in sync with the vision of ‘Invest Punjab’, all industries being set up in the area will have the advantage of 100 per cent exemption of stamp duty, 100 per cent exemption of electricity duty for seven years, 100 per cent exemption from property tax and an investment subsidy too.

Further, the Industry units will be entitled to collateral-free bank loans, a one per cent interest exemption on an overdraft, 50 per cent discount on government fee on trademarks, credit linked capital subsidy scheme for technical up-gradation and many other benefits.
